If Mike V invested his money wisely and wants to launch a brand that will be a true reflection of what his idea of a company should be, but will be lucky to break even, that would be totally possible.

If however he thinks the new brand he is creating will "blow up" and be a profit making venture, I don't see it.

I can't think of any start up board company that has really made it in today's market. The only new companies that I can think of are offshoots of other brands. Deathwish from Baker. Slave from Zero.

Best of luck to him though. I thought the berrics episodes of him recently were spectacular.
